The sweet and dessert wine Dorsheimer Goldloch Auslese, vintage 2004 from the winery Schlossgut Diel has been rated in 2005 with 91 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Riesling from the region Nahe in Germany.
Tasting Notes
Pale greenish yellow, intense, juicy tropical fruit on the nose, very developed on the palate, fruit cocktail, harmonious, a little runny at the moment, elegant, the acidity remains in the background, still very youthful, a touch underdeveloped.
